Welcome to Quarantine
Generation 2.0, like most small retailers at the time of the pandemic, was uncertain how to proceed with business as usual during lock-down. Instead of dropping the originally planned Spring-Summer edit for the upcoming season, it was decisively scrapped in favor of starting anew.

Hello, New Inspo!
With much of the world melting down, TikTok starting to blow up, misinformation ablaze, and caregivers of all kinds ready to explode, fire seemed an inescapable, if not inevitable, concept to be explored in the moodboard compilation below. Although the brightly hued, boldly colored, palette against black & white imagery was unplanned, the aesthetic also felt particularly poignant given the warm weather ahead.

Collection Overview
A one-time only, limited edition drop consisting of a smaller than usual assortment of fashion apparel & accessories, featuring one of a kind graphics, handcrafted accessories, and eye-catching embellishments. Created during the pandemic, as a sort of reaction to the pandemic in real time, it was designed, executed, and delivered in under a month.

#FashionTotes
In the style sheet below, the original blank totes came with matching, yellow canvas, straps. These were uniformly removed & replaced (by hand) with the gold-toned hardware displayed in the "Elements" section. Fashion wise, it made a huge difference as seen in the final tote designs.
